Hi Everyone

I need some help

I’m currently selfhosting some of my applications on Digital Ocean and i run a container using Portainer CE. I was wondering how you guys keep backups for the applications running on docker.

I’m currently using Digital ocean’s snapshots feature but is there a better way i could use, any help on this is highly appreciated.

  • lgLindstromB
    link
    fedilink
    English
    arrow-up
    1
    ·
    1 year ago

    When backing up Docker volumes, should not the docker container be stopped first.?? I can’t se any support for that in the backup tools mentioned.

  • KltpzyxmmB
    link
    fedilink
    English
    arrow-up
    1
    ·
    1 year ago

    I have bind mounts to nfs shares that are backed my zfs pools and last snapshots and sync jobs to another storage device. All containers are ephemeral.

  • carlinhushB
    link
    fedilink
    English
    arrow-up
    1
    ·
    1 year ago

    Unraid with Duplicacy and Appdata Backup incremental to Backblaze

  • billiarddaddyB
    link
    fedilink
    English
    arrow-up
    1
    ·
    1 year ago

    Most of mine are lightweight so private repos on git.

    For big data I have two NAS that sync on the daily.

  • TheonB
    link
    fedilink
    English
    arrow-up
    1
    ·
    1 year ago

    As others said, use volume mounts, and I incrementally backup those with borg to minimize storage space requirements

  • bufandatlB
    link
    fedilink
    English
    arrow-up
    1
    ·
    1 year ago

    I use rdiff-backup to backup the volumes directory of my VPS to a local machine via VPN. Containers are stored in some public registry anyways. Also use ansible with all the configurations and container settings.

  • clonecharle1B
    link
    fedilink
    English
    arrow-up
    1
    ·
    1 year ago

    A few hard drives that are stored offsite and rotate every few weeks.